Quick Comparison

2.4GHz systems are typically the simplest to set up and work well for rehearsals, small venues, and portable rigs. UHF systems usually offer more channel flexibility and can be a better fit for larger stages or users who need more control over interference. Stereo systems give a more spacious, detailed mix, while mono systems are often simpler, more stable, and easier to manage live.

Key Buying Factors for Wired in Ear Monitoring Systems for Musicians

Latency and Stability

Low latency matters when you need your vocals or instrument to feel immediate. Stable signal performance is equally important, especially in crowded RF environments or venues with lots of wireless gear.

Stereo Vs. Mono

Stereo can improve separation and positional awareness, which is useful in studio-style monitoring or more polished live rigs. Mono is often the safer choice if you want a straightforward, reliable cue mix that works across more situations.

Range and Coverage

Check the usable operating distance, not just the headline number. Real-world range can vary based on walls, crowd density, and other wireless devices.

Channel Count and Expandability

If you run a full band, multiple receivers or selectable channels can matter a lot. Solo performers may only need a simple transmitter-and-receiver set, while larger groups should look for systems built to handle more users.

Comfort, Power, and Durability

Bodypack size, clip quality, battery runtime, and build materials all affect day-to-day use. Musicians who gig often should favor systems that are easy to wear, easy to recharge or power, and rugged enough for repeated setup.

Who Should Buy Which Wired in Ear Monitoring Systems for Musicians?

If you want a simple, affordable setup for practice or small gigs, 2.4GHz entry-level systems are often the easiest starting point. If you play live in a more demanding wireless environment, a UHF model with more frequencies may be the better fit. Bands that need several performers monitored at once should look for multi-channel or multi-bodypack options, while studio users may prefer stereo systems with cleaner separation and more detail.

In short, the best choice depends on how many musicians you need to cover, how complex your stage setup is, and whether you value convenience, expandability, or the most reliable signal possible.
